    After dinner, I let my friend choose the place for drinks since she's the local. She took us to one…read moreof her favourite bars, Domkeller, which I'd classify as a dive bar. We dropped in on a Tuesday evening (around 9:15pm) and it was busy. There was a private event upstairs so the inside was packed. Luckily, we were able to snag a table outside beside the heaters. Nice touch with the blankets for you to use if you get cold. Only downside is lots of chain smokers but that's at most bars. There were a couple menus but we only were here for beers (€2,50 to €5,80 range). - Tannenzäpfle (€2,50 for 0,33L) - 2x Eifeler landbier (€2,50 for 0,30L) - 2x Bolten alt (€2,50 for 0,30L) Chill, laid back spot to grab a few beers with friends.

    So they open up at 4PM, which is slightly early for the 5 O'clock drink, but hey I'm not local and…read morewhere else would you expect to find an Irishman...... I had the good fortune of being the one and only patron for the first hour and I sat and talked to the owner, Pieter. This place just has that authentic Irish feel to it. I actually walked a half a mile past another Irish pub that was closer to my hotel to get to this one. Maastricht does not have as much exposure to Yelp, so I actually had to look for a recommendation on another site. That is exactly why I am reviewing this restaurant. Yelpers need to know this place! I enjoyed a Smithwick's on tap. The beer was extremely cold, and the pint was a perfect pour! However, the biggest draw for me was the fish and chips. They are absolutely delicious! The fish is a rather large piece, done right in beer batter. It is also extremely flaky and I consider this a good thing! The pub is also known to be a good place to watch European football. The TVs are hooked up to sound and broadcast in HD. Whether you're looking for a good pint, good food or just to enjoy a football game, this is your place.     From the owner: In Deutschland wird seit über 500 Jahren mit den gleichen Zutaten gebraut:  Hopfen+Malz, Wasser und…read moreHefe. Doch es gibt Länder, in denen auch andere Zutaten im Braukessel landen. Schon mal ein Bier mit Sauerkrautsaft oder Wachholderbeeren probiert?   Wir möchten Euch gerne in die Welt der Biere begleiten und deshalb haben wir uns so einiges einfallen lassen: Ihr könnt zusammen mit unserem Biersommelier kreative   oder auch alt bekannte Biere brauen oder an einer Bierverkostung teilnehmen, bei der 6 verschiedene, internationale Biere vorgestellt und genau unter die Lupe genommen werden oder die Welt der Biere in Kombination mit Essen kennenlernen. Diese Events sind reservierungspflichtig. Wir haben zudem einen Gastraum mit ca. 50 Sitzplätzen und einen Bierladen mit einer riesigen Auswahl an Bieren aus der ganzen Welt.
